Update copyright notice and fix entitlement key sizes
This change updates the copyright notice to make it more clear that the code is distribued under the Widevine Master License Agreement. It also updates the unit tests and sample code to correct the useage of AES 256. AES 256 is used to decrypt entitled content keys, but it is not used to decrypt key control blocks.
